My chromatic tuner started misbehaving after a battery leak, and rather than agree with its assessment that every sound was B4, I decided to replace it with a software tuner. I found a wonderful fast-fourier spectrum analyzer and set about modifying it to suit my purposes. I used the technique of combining harmonics to identify the fundamental frequency as described in a paper by Mary Lourde R. and Anjali Kuppayil Saji. I also added a noise-sampling feature, some low-frequency attenuation, and a nice display.

Launch Pitcher